It either registers a "simple-framebuffer" for the simple{fb,drm} drivers or legacy VGA/EFI FB devices for the vgafb/efifb drivers. Besides this, the EFI initialization code used by other architectures such as aarch64 and riscv, has similar logic but only register an EFI FB device. The sysfb is generic enough to be reused by other architectures and can be moved out of the arch/x86 directory to drivers/firmware, allowing the EFI logic used by non-x86 architectures to be folded into sysfb as well. Patch #1 in this series do the former while patch #2 the latter. This has been tested on x86_64 and aarch64 machines using the efifb, simplefb and simpledrm drivers. But more testing will be highly appreciated, to make sure that no regressions are being introduced by these changes. Since this touches both arch/{x86,arm,arm64,riscv} and drivers/firmware, I don't know how it should be merged. But I didn't find a way to split these.
